Output d6d52a79bd73426994ee88c11c299eae01cefed42663dcf3f430057289b3c77b:0

value
4825440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96f5b5e94af64f55095e82399aa7ba081e527c2 OP_EQUAL
address
3QRuaXK1foMy9NJ9jPE9EFnndwQNUpN8bg
transaction
d6d52a79bd73426994ee88c11c299eae01cefed42663dcf3f430057289b3c77b
confirmations
402572
spent
true